What Are Dental Veneers?

Dental veneers are thin, custom-made shells designed to cover the front surface of your teeth. These shells are typically made from porcelain or resin composite material and are designed to improve the overall appearance of your teeth. Veneers can correct various dental imperfections, including:

  • Discoloration: Stains and discolorations from food, beverages, or smoking can diminish the brilliance of your smile.
  • Chips and Cracks: Daily activities can cause wear and tear on your teeth, leading to chips and cracks.
  • Misalignment: Uneven or crooked teeth can impact your confidence when smiling.
  • Gaps: Spaces between teeth can give an unbalanced appearance.

The Procedure for Getting Veneers

The journey to a perfect smile with veneers begins with a consultation with a qualified cosmetic dentist in Dallas. Here’s what you can typically expect during the process:

1. Consultation and Treatment Planning

Your dentist will assess your dental health and discuss your desired outcomes. This phase may include:

  • X-rays and photographs of your teeth.
  • Discussion about the shade and style of veneers that suit your smile.
  • Creation of a personalized treatment plan.

2. Tooth Preparation

In most cases, a small amount of enamel is removed from the front of the teeth to make room for the veneers. This process is crucial for ensuring that the veneers sit properly and look natural.

3. Impression Taking

Your dentist will take impressions of your prepared teeth, which will be sent to a dental lab to create the custom veneers. This process may take about 1-2 weeks.

4. Temporary Veneers

While waiting for your custom veneers, temporary veneers may be placed to protect your teeth and maintain your smile's aesthetics.

5. Veneer Placement

Once your custom veneers are ready, your dentist will remove the temporary ones and carefully bond the new veneers to your teeth using a special adhesive.

6. Follow-Up Care

A follow-up appointment may be scheduled to ensure proper fit and comfort. Regular dental check-ups will help maintain your veneers and overall oral health.

Maintaining Your Veneers for Longevity

To ensure the longevity of your veneers, it is essential to practice good oral hygiene and adopt some additional care tips:

  • Brush and Floss Daily: Maintain a rigorous oral hygiene routine by brushing twice a day and flossing daily to prevent decay around the veneers.
  • Avoid Hard Foods: Stay away from hard foods that could chip or crack your veneers, such as ice or hard candies.
  • Regular Dental Visits: Schedule regular check-ups with your dentist every six months to monitor the health of your veneers and perform any necessary adjustments.

Cost of Veneers in Dallas

The cost of veneers can vary significantly based on various factors, including:

  • Material Used: Porcelain veneers are generally more expensive than composite veneers.
  • Number of Veneers Needed: The more veneers you need, the higher the total cost.
  • Practitioner’s Experience: Highly experienced cosmetic dentists may charge more for their expertise.

On average, dental veneers can range from $1,000 to $2,500 per tooth. It’s advisable to consult with your dentist regarding payment plans and insurance coverage that may be available.
